{"title":"Ethernet bridge for FSO links","authors":"M. Kubícek, Z. Kolka","doi":"10.1109/RADIOELEK.2009.5158741","DOIUrl":"https://doi.org/10.1109/RADIOELEK.2009.5158741","url":null,"abstract":"The paper deals with a bridge for atmospheric Free-Space Optical links. The atmospheric turbulence causes fades whose duration is typically in the order of tens of milliseconds, which results in the loss of hundreds or thousands of packets. The loss is misinterpreted by the TCP protocol as network congestion and leads to throttling the sender transmission data rate to a fraction of real channel capacity. The proposed Ethernet-to-FSO bridge uses ARQ procedures on the FSO channel to mitigate the packet loss on the link layer. The bridge is based on Xilinx Virtex-5 FPGA with additional memory for buffers. A special link protocol for the FSO path has been designed. FSO frames can carry complete Ethernet frames without fragmentation.","PeriodicalId":285174,"journal":{"name":"2009 19th International Conference Radioelektronika","volume":"24 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2009-04-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"134057063","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
